Regulation FD Disclosure --------------------------------- On January 22, 2002, the Registrant announced guidance of $0.63 to $0.64 per share fully diluted EPS for the first quarter of fiscal 2002. On January 22, 2002, the Registrant also confirmed comfort with its previously stated range of $2.60 to $2.70 per share for 2002 fully diluted EPS. These ranges do not include the effect of FAS 142, Goodwill and Other Intangible Assets, which changes the accounting for goodwill from an amortization method to an impairment-only method. Upon adoption of FAS 142, effective January 1, 2002, the Registrant has discontinued amortization of current goodwill. The Registrant estimates the addition to annual fully diluted EPS as a result of FAS 142 to be approximately $0.32 to $0.33 per share, or approximately $0.08 per share quarterly. All acquisitions by the Registrant to date have been accounted for under APB 16, which is being superceded by FAS 141 and 142. As a result of the FASB announcement in November 2001 concerning the applicability of FAS 72 to certain banking acquisitions, the Registrant has reviewed its accounting for previous acquisition transactions. At the present time, the Registrant does not believe that FAS 72 is applicable to those acquisitions. The FASB is presently deliberating the continued application of FAS 72 and how it should be applied to banking transactions. Additional FASB guidance is expected prior to the end of this year.
